If you own a 2016 Ford Mustang, you know the thrill of hitting the open road, but to keep that power roaring, it’s essential to pay attention to your ignition coil boots. These little guys are vital for maintaining a strong connection between your ignition coils and spark plugs, ensuring everything fires up smoothly. To keep them in top shape, regular inspections for cracks, wear, or corrosion are a must; after all, they are your vehicle’s unsung heroes! Common symptoms of failing ignition coil boots include rough idling, misfiring, or a check engine light that just won’t quit. Addressing these issues early can help prevent more extensive damage and keep your Mustang performing at its peak. When you’re diving into the replacement of ignition coil boots, it’s a good idea to have a few related products on hand to make your job easier and more efficient. You’ll likely need some new ignition coils themselves if they’re due for a change, along with dielectric grease to ensure a solid seal and prevent moisture from causing corrosion. Special tools like a ratchet set and socket wrenches will help you tackle those stubborn bolts; if you’re working on more complex setups, a torque wrench is handy for achieving the right tightness. Don’t forget your safety gear, like gloves and goggles, to protect yourself from sharp edges and electrical components while you’re in the trenches—after all, safety first ensures you can keep DIYing for years to come!
